Most of our suffering comes from resisting what is already here, particularly our feelings. All any feeling wants is to be welcomed, touched, allowed. It wants attention. It wants kindness. If you treated your feelings with as much love as you treated your dog or your cat or your child, you'd feel as if you were living in heaven every day of your sweet life. Geneen Roth
About This Quote

If we would love our feelings as much as we love our pet, we would feel as if we were living in heaven every day of our sweet life. If we would accept our emotional pain as well as our physical pain, then that pain would no longer be there to cause us pain. It wouldn’t matter how many times we fell down or made mistakes. We could just get up and start over again.
